As the Old adage goes Tamika has been singing ever since she could open her mouth. Tamika started singing for Audiences at the age of nine and right from the beginning you could see that this child was born to perform, She was quite small for her age but her vibrant personality certainly made up for any lack of height, she was not the prettiest or the most well dressed and she was more comfortable up in a tree than putting on makeup or having tea parties but when this vibrant young lady opened her mouth to sing all would stop to listen and be in awe of a voice that sounded way beyond her years.Tamika started doing amature musical theatre from 9yo with Murray Music and Drama group and performed any chance she got. At the ripe old age of 12yo Tamika performed at the W.A. Young perfomer of the year awards against contantestants that were up to twice her age and not only took out her age group but also the overall young acheiver award but if you were to ask Tamika what the highlight of the night was she would tell you it was meeting Chris Murphy who was an Australian Idol Finalist. Tamika was asked to sing with the local Orchestra and did many local events as a live singer with a live Orchestra, they often joked about how she could sing as loud as they could play and once even had to compete with boat racing, Tamika was very proud of the fact that they could still hear her nicely even with all the noise in the background. At 13yo Tamika and her Family Moved to Remote Northern Territory to a little Town called Nhulunbuy in Arnhem Land, whilst in Nhulunbuy Tamika became a valued part of the Town, singing the National Anthem for Australia Day and Territory Day, at the local Markets and Fundraising Events this helped her to earn the Australia Day Medallion in 2009 followed by many other Awards and Nominations for her efforts. While she was still in Nhulunbuy Tamika teemed up with a group of like minded young girls and formed the band Sync, the wrote 3 songs together and contributed to a CD brought out by her Highschool to help raise funds. In 2010 at 15yo Tamika Competed in Gove Idol where she recieved the Highest score ever reported in the History of the Competition with a haunting rendition of Whitney Houston's I will always love you, the organisers of the event were Impressed with this young lady that they flew their manager Mr Barry Conlon up to see for himself, he was so Impressed that he was quoted as saying that she had the potential to be the Next Kylie Monogue and encouraged Tamika's parents to Get her to a Major City, Tamika also got a Opportunity to sing at the Invite Only major Indigenous Event GARMA and be a Opening Act for Mental as Anything. In Jan 2011 Tamika and her Mum moved to Victoria where Tamika Joined Rockstar Experience and found her Inner Rock Chick and started singing coveres from The Darkness, The Beetles, Led Zeplin and ACDC. Tamika is now a 17yo young Lady who has learned to appreciate a bit of makeup and getting dressed up but still has a contagious vibrant personality and a glitter in her eyes that will make you want to listen to a voice that will leave you in awe. | bioFeature_2270_08137DEF-CB95-40F7-B6FF-21F437E449D3.jpg |
